The Ethics Police? The Struggle to Make Human Research Safe  provides insight into the influential but secretive institutional-review boards that decide whether scientific research using human subjects meets ethical standards. Robert Klitzman ’80 sheds light on the internal workings of this little-understood system and discusses possible improvements. Klitzman is a professor of psychiatry at Columbia University.
